Release 14 of the PFRPG2 ruleset has been made available in the live channel today for both FG Classic and FG Unity. After updating, you can confirm you have the most recent ruleset by checking for “PF2 Release 14” in the chat window ruleset message.
This release is a bit of a catch all – bug fixes, minor changes, updates for future products, etc..

Migrated NPC abilities from single string controls to windowlist with title and text.
As part of the upcoming official Bestiary release, the previous 4 NPC data fields (interaction abilities, aura, reactive abilities and offensive/proactive abilities) have been replaced by 3 windowlist sections – that allow each ability to have a header/title and core descriptive text. The three new windowlists are Interaction abilities, reactive abilities and offensive/proactive abilities.
The ruleset makes an attempt to populate these windowlists from the old fields data. It will get it right most of the time, but there may be occasions when the data won’t be separated into distinct ability title/description pairs. The data won’t be lost, it just might be in different ability records and require a bit of manual editing.
All of the current DLC has been updated to use this format.
NPC attack line now has three sections highlighted - attack, traits and damage. Attack traits open in a single window.
This allows the double-clicking of attack traits. If the traits can be looked up (usually in the Core Rules DLC module, which should be activated for this to work) a single window will open showing info about all the traits that are present in the Campaign traits list.

NPC attack lines not parsing correctly in FG Unity
The attack lines will work in Unity - with version 2020-04-15 or higher.
Action symbol replacement
Replacement will now work for the fields and codes detailed in the Wiki here: https://www.fantasygrounds.com/wiki/index.php/PFRPG2_Action_Symbols ALT codes will not work in Unity.
